SIDNEY T. SPOOR GRIFFITH,
IN
Sidney T. Spoor, age 68, of Griffith,
passed away February 18, 2013.
He is survived by his wife, Mary; two sons: Robert (Jean) Spoor and Daniel
(Sunshine Woods) Spoor; three granddaughters: Lotus, Evora, and Novella;
mother, Eleanor; one brother, Larry (Julieanne) Spoor; and many nieces and
nephews. A memorial service will be held Friday, February 22, 2013 at 6:00
PM at Kuiper Funeral Home, 9039
Kleinman Road (two blocks south of Ridge
Rd.), Highland, IN
with Rev. Robert Parnell officiating. Friends may visit with the family on
Friday from 4:00-6:00 p.m. (time of
services) at the funeral home. Sidney
was a veteran of the Vietnam
era. He was a member of The Dune Land Wood Carvers and an avid chainsaw carver.

A Message From Sidney Spoor (The Woodlander)
I have been carving wood for over 25 years. I have
studied the techniques of various carvers and other artists and have tried to
implement their best talents in developing my artistic style. Although
I mostly enjoy carving animals, I also find it enjoyable to carve other types
of wildlife such as ducks, songbirds, and fish. The pictures on this
web site bear testament to my dedication to the art of woodcarving.
Browsing through the pictures may inspire you to commission me to create a
beautiful carving of your own. I am a member of The Duneland Woodcarvers, the
National Wood Carvers Association, and the Indiana Wildlife Artists.
